Peak torque per unit cross-sectional area differs between strength-trained and untrained young adults.

Abstract

It is unclear whether gender differences in the relative strength of the upper and lower body are due to differences in muscle mass distribution or dissimilarity of use. There is also controversy as to whether prolonged resistance training increases strength per unit cross-sectional area (CSA). To help resolve these questions, maximum isometric torque per unit muscle and bone (M+B) CSA was measured in the upper arm and thigh of 26 trained (13 males; 13 females) and 26 untrained (13 males; 13 females) young adults. Muscle and bone CSA values were calculated from limb circumferences and skinfolds. Maximal isometric torque values were recorded by a LIDO isokinetic dynamometer. There was no significant difference (P > 0.05) in mean upper arm or thigh torque per unit M+B CSA between the trained males and trained females, or between the untrained males and untrained females. However, mean torque per unit M+B CSA was significantly higher for the trained subjects of both genders compared with the untrained subjects of both genders for the upper arm (28.9%; P < 0.0001) and thigh (18.8%; P < 0.0001). These results suggest that muscle quality (peak torque/CSA) is equal between genders, and that the increase in muscle strength per unit area that occurs with resistance training is not gender-dependent.

摘要

上半身和下半身相对力量的性别差异是由于肌肉质量分布的差异还是使用方式的不同尚不清楚。对于长期的阻力训练是否会增加单位横截面积(CSA)的力量也存在争议。为了帮助解决这些问题,我们测量了26名受过训练的(13名男性;13名女性)和26名未受过训练的(13名男性;13名女性)年轻成年人上臂和大腿每单位肌肉和骨骼(M+B)CSA的最大等长扭矩。肌肉和骨骼CSA值根据肢体周长和皮褶厚度计算得出。最大等长扭矩值由LIDO等速测力计记录。受过训练的男性和受过训练的女性之间,以及未受过训练的男性和未受过训练的女性之间,每单位M+B CSA的上臂或大腿平均扭矩没有显著差异(P>0.05)。然而,与未受过训练的男女受试者相比,受过训练的男女受试者每单位M+B CSA的上臂平均扭矩显著更高(28.9%;P<0.0001),大腿平均扭矩也显著更高(18.8%;P<0.0001)。这些结果表明,性别之间的肌肉质量(峰值扭矩/CSA)是相等的,并且阻力训练引起的单位面积肌肉力量增加与性别无关。
